In 2007, the Freedom Campervan was ready for launch after extensive road trials. We met with the CEO and MD of Tata Motors, Mr. Ravi Kant to showcase the transformation of Telcoline into the Freedom Campervan.
Impressed with this brilliant feat, Mr. Ravi Kant, facilitated the launch of the Freedom Campervan, at the 6th Annual Convention of the Adventure Tour Operators Association of India-ATOAI, Delhi, on 17th & 18th December 2007. Thus, cementing the idea of Campervans in India.
The story of Overlanders began in 1996. Inspired by travels throughout Ladakh and further traveling overland throughout large parts of Australia and New Zealand in 1997-98. This experience gave rise to the idea of making overland travel comfortable in India.
Our founder, an avid traveller with a keen eye for detail, envisioned the possibility of campervans in India, that would offer both luxury and practicality.
After extensive research and creating a short list of potential vehicles; We set up meetings with various automotive vehicle manufacturers to find the perfect fit for Overlanders. We zeroed down on the TATA LT 4×4 Pick-up platform which met with all our design requirements for a compact Camper in Indian conditions.
The TATA Telcoline 4×4 platform was purely an export vehicle and not available for sale in India. After discussions with the Head of all India Sales-Chief, Rudrarup Maitra, we had the opportunity to meet the Chairman of Tata Motors, Shri. Ratan Tata to discuss the bright future of overland travel in India. Inspired by our vision, Shri. Ratan Tata facilitated the sale of Tata Telcoline 4×4 by homologating the vehicle and making way for the first ever campervan based on a pick-up platform in India in the year 2004.
This association with Tata Motors, enabled us to interact with their Engineering Research Centre (ERC Department) in getting invaluable inputs for making the Freedom Campervan which helped us operate within the ARAI guidelines.

The Founder was part of Ministry of Road Transport and Highways (MORTH) initiative for making the Automotive Industry Standards (AIS) for Motor Caravans in India, by being a Member of CENTRAL MOTOR VEHICLE RULES – TECHNICAL STANDING COMMITTEE (TSC) SET-UP BY MINISTRY OF ROAD TRANSPORT and HIGHWAYS (DEPARTMENT OF ROAD TRANSPORT and HIGHWAYS) GOVERNMENT OF INDIA and ARAI, Pune (THE AUTOMOTIVE RESEARCH ASSOCIATION OF INDIA)
Which finally came up with “Procedure for Type Approval and Certification of Motor Caravans for compliance to Central Motor Vehicles Rules” known as AIS-124.
Active participation in formation of the Caravan Tourism Policy and Caravan Parks in India.
